Unravel Two
Unravel Two is a beautiful and charming puzzle platformer where you control two yarn creatures. Working together, you’ll solve intricate puzzles that require both strategy and coordination. The game’s stunning visuals and heartwarming story make it a truly special co-op experience.
Overcooked! 2
Prepare for culinary chaos in Overcooked! 2! This frantic cooking game will test your teamwork and communication skills to the limit. With increasingly absurd levels and quirky challenges, Overcooked! 2 is guaranteed to provide hours of laughter and frustration. Learn to coordinate effectively to avoid kitchen catastrophes! It Takes Two
Hailed as a masterpiece of co-op gaming, It Takes Two offers a unique and unforgettable adventure. This game showcases exceptional level design and inventive gameplay mechanics that truly require collaboration. Diablo III
For fans of action RPGs, Diablo III is a classic co-op choice. Hack and slash your way through hordes of demons with your friends, customizing your characters and building powerful synergies. Portal 2
Portal 2 takes the mind-bending puzzle gameplay of its predecessor to new heights with fantastic co-op campaign. Work together with a friend to solve challenging puzzles using portals and witty banter. It’s challenging, rewarding, and hilarious, showcasing the power of teamwork in solving complex problems. Gears 5
If you enjoy cover-based shooters, Gears 5 offers an intense and rewarding co-op experience. Team up with your friends to battle hordes of enemies in stunning environments. Deep Rock Galactic
Prepare for some deep space mining in Deep Rock Galactic! This cooperative first-person shooter will have you and your friends working together to mine valuable resources while battling waves of terrifying alien creatures. The game features four unique classes, each with their own strengths and weaknesses, requiring strategic teamwork to survive. [IMAGE_6_HERE]
